Root and etymology

מ־ל־כ

reign

In context2 Kings 16:5

Then Retsin king of Aram and Pekah son of Remaliah king of Israel went up to Jerusalem to make war , and they besieged Ahaz , but they were not able to fight him.

About this coordinate

2 Kings 16:5:7 is a BCV:P reference — Book · Chapter · Verse · Word Position. It addresses word 7 of 2 Kings 16:5, so the Hebrew word מֶֽלֶךְ־יִשְׂרָאֵ֛ל (melekhyisrael) can be cited, linked and studied at exactly this position rather than somewhere in the verse. In the Biblical Knowledge Coordinate System the same position is written 2 Kgs.16.5.W7, which extends further down to each syllable (2 Kgs.16.5.W7.S1) and character.
